Christy & Stephanie both win for IBC in Bristol
Posted: 11th June 2012 by Reggie Hagland in Club ResultsIslington boxing Club celebrated a memorable double win on the Barton Hill Show in Bristol (at the Artspace College) on Saturday 9th June.
Junior boxer Christy McCarthy’s constant aggression and work rate proving too much for young Damien Garrett (Trowbridge), in an entertaining contest. It was fast paced with McCarthy always just a step ahead, his right hand time and again finding the target. In the second, McCarthy threatened to overwhelm Garrett, but the Trowbridge boxer dug deep to hang on to the bell. The final session was all McCarthy as he swarmed all over Garrett who had no answer to the Islington boxer’s higher work rate. The Islington boxer won via unanimous decision.

In a female contest at Welterwieight, Stephanie Louis-Fernand comfortably outpointed former under 75 kgs ABAE national finalist Lucia Gaetani. Fernand, stood tall in the opener pumping out crisp jab, while Gaetani looked to get close and work inside. Gaetani did her best work in the second round, as she managed to neutralise Louis-Fernand’s jab, by keeping the action at close quarters. In the last, the eye catching punches, especially the long right hands from Louis-Fernand helped make up the judges minds. The judges decision was unanimous.The pair could meet again in the Haringey Box Cup later this month.
